61822928 has 20 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 123646848. Its totient is φ = 29914080.
The previous prime is 61822921. The next prime is 61822933. The reversal of 61822928 is 82922816.
61822928 is an admirable number.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 61822891 and 61822900.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(61822921)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 61826 + ... + 62817.
Almost surely, 261822928 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
61822928 is a primitive ab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ors, none of which is abundant.
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
61822928 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
61822928 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 124682 (or 124676 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its digits is 27648, while the sum is 38.
The square root of 61822928 is about 7862.7557510074. The cubic root of 61822928 is about 395.4120104113.
The spelling of 61822928 in words is "sixty-one million, eight hundred twenty-two thousand, nine hundred twenty-eight".
